Smoking is dated as early as 500 BC, & these days, about 1.1 billion people, and up to 1/three of the grownup populace have interaction in smoking. according to a brand new observe, the smoke emerged from cigarettes can block the self-restoration process in lungs and can, therefore, cause chronic obstructive pulmonary sickness.This locating has been mentioned in the American journal of respiratory and critical Care medication by way of the researchers at the Helmholtz Zentrum Munchen, accomplice within the German Centre for Lung research (DZL), and their global colleagues.

The typical signs of COPD include a cough, bronchitis and respiratory problems. even though exact figures aren't to be had, the estimates are that 10 to 12% of adults over 40 years of age in Germany be afflicted by the ailment. experts have envisioned the country-wide economic fees of the ailment at nearly six billion euros annually. Scientists around the sector are making efforts to find out how the ailment is developed and what biological modifications can be made to prevent it.



one of the strategies worried the lung's natural self-restoration, which no longer takes vicinity in COPD. "In healthy sufferers, the so-called WNT/beta-catenin signalling pathway is answerable for the lung's homoeostasis. until now, it was now not clear why it become silenced in patients with COPD said Dr. Melanie Konigsh off, head of the Lung repair and Regeneration studies Unit of the comprehensive Pneumology centre (CPC) at Helmholtz Zentrum Munchen. She and her team spent the last some years tackling this question within the framework of an ERC beginning furnish and found that one of the Frizzled molecules - Frizzled four - played a critical function.

"Frizzled 4 is a receptor molecule that sits on the floor of lung cells, wherein it regulates their self-renewal through WNT/beta-catenin," stated author Wioletta Skronska-Wasek, doctoral candidate on the LRR. "but if the cells are uncovered to cigarette smoke, Frizzled four disappears from the surface and cellular increase involves a halt.
"

The current observe's starting point turned into the group's commentary that within the lung tissue of COPD patients, and specifically that of smokers, there were brilliant low Frizzled 4 receptors than in non-peoples who smoke "inside the next step, we were capable of prove in cellular subculture & version systems that inhibition of Frizzled four signalling on the cells caused reduced WNT/beta-catenin activity and consequently to decreased wound healing and restore ability," stated Dr Alinder Yildirim, an expert on the results of cigarette smoke within the lung. The authors additionally diagnosed that without the receptor, there has been a loss of certain proteins that are important for the shape of lung tissue (together with elastin, fibulin and IGF1) and the lung's elasticity, allowing sufferers to breathe.






To verify their results, the scientists artificially stronger the Frizzled 4 tiers in a cell subculture test to stimulate its production. The growth in Frizzled four degree reactivated the blocked repair technique and caused the production of most of the formerly decreased proteins.

"The activation of the Frizzled four receptor can repair the WNT/beta-catenin signalling pathway and thereforeresult in restore within the lung," stated Melanie Konigshoff. that is an interesting start line for similarlyresearch which may increase new treatments for COPD patients.
